6f4957d821 fix(use-keyboard-shortcuts): enforce symmetric modifier matching
Modifiers (shift, alt, meta) are now checked in both directions:
when not required, the physical key must NOT be pressed either.

Before: Cmd+K shortcut would fire on Cmd+Shift+K or Cmd+Alt+K.
After: exact modifier combination is enforced.

4 regression tests added.

saravanakumardb1
46ee14371c fix(ci): add --pool forks to all vitest test scripts to fix kill EPERM on Node v25
Root cause: tinypool worker teardown calls kill() which returns EPERM
in the act_runner host environment on Node.js v25.2.1. Tests pass but
the vitest process crashes during cleanup, causing CI failure.

Fix: --pool forks CLI flag on every package/service test script, plus
pool: 'forks' in all vitest.config.ts files. This uses child_process.fork()
worker management which handles termination cleanly.

60 package.json files updated, 10 vitest.config.ts files updated.

9471d4c56f fix(test): add @vitest-environment happy-dom to React UI test files
6 test files across 4 packages (auth-ui, dashboard-components,
dashboard-shell, react-auth) failed with 'document is not defined'
when run from the monorepo root because the root vitest config uses
environment: 'node'. The package-local configs set happy-dom but are
ignored when vitest is invoked from root.

Fix: Add per-file '// @vitest-environment happy-dom' annotations,
which is the recommended vitest pattern for mixed-environment monorepos.
This ensures tests work regardless of which config is loaded.

Recovers 148 tests across 6 files.

4a47db72ae fix(flags): SSE stream endpoint + client — pass productId via query string
EventSource API cannot set custom headers, so the SSE /flags/stream
endpoint and feature-flag-client were broken for streaming mode:
- Server: accept productId and token from query string as fallback
  when x-product-id / authorization headers are absent
- Client: pass productId (and optional auth token) as query params
  when constructing the EventSource URL
